Reviewed by C. L. Rossman

Kate White's crime-solving heroine Bailey Weggins returns in this latest book. Weggins, who reports on celebrity crimes for the weekly gossip magazine Buzz, is asked by an old male friend, Chris Wickersham, to look into the disappearance of a fellow actor, Tom Fain, who vanished without a trace one weekend. Chris and he are filming the new TV show Morgue, and if he doesn't show up, the show might not go on. Plus, Chris just might be still interested in Bailey.

Once this celebrity crime reporter sinks her teeth into a case, she's like a bulldog with a bone that won't let go. The trouble is, the deeper she gets into the case, the closer the show Morgue starts to resemble the real thing.

Besides this series, author Kate White is the editor-in-chief of Cosmopolitan Magazine and has a New York Times bestseller as well. She has a nice touch with plot and dialogue. The only thing that confused me was exactly who the lethal blond was...the missing Tom, Bailey, Chris? Or the villain who doesn't seem to be blonde? But that's my take--not being familiar with the series.

That aside, this a light, entertaining and enjoyable read with a crime solving character who is becoming very well-known in mystery fiction.

Armchair Interviews says: Fun and light read with a good storyline.
